Skip to content

Commit

Permalink
Added Pod Dependencies
Browse files Browse the repository at this point in the history
  • Loading branch information
jindulys committed Feb 21, 2016
1 parent 1884e15 commit 90b054c
Show file tree
Hide file tree
Showing 166 changed files with 11,517 additions and 0 deletions.
162 changes: 162 additions & 0 deletions GithubPilot.xcodeproj/project.pbxproj

Large diffs are not rendered by default.

10 changes: 10 additions & 0 deletions GithubPilot.xcworkspace/contents.xcworkspacedata

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

89 changes: 89 additions & 0 deletions GithubPilotTests/FakeData/repo.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,89 @@
{
"id": 10824973,
"name": "Test",
"full_name": "mietzmithut/Test",
"owner": {
"login": "mietzmithut",
"id": 4672699,
"avatar_url": "https://avatars.githubusercontent.com/u/4672699?v=3",
"gravatar_id": "",
"url": "https://api.github.com/users/mietzmithut",
"html_url": "https://github.com/mietzmithut",
"followers_url": "https://api.github.com/users/mietzmithut/followers",
"following_url": "https://api.github.com/users/mietzmithut/following{/other_user}",
"gists_url": "https://api.github.com/users/mietzmithut/gists{/gist_id}",
"starred_url": "https://api.github.com/users/mietzmithut/starred{/owner}{/repo}",
"subscriptions_url": "https://api.github.com/users/mietzmithut/subscriptions",
"organizations_url": "https://api.github.com/users/mietzmithut/orgs",
"repos_url": "https://api.github.com/users/mietzmithut/repos",
"events_url": "https://api.github.com/users/mietzmithut/events{/privacy}",
"received_events_url": "https://api.github.com/users/mietzmithut/received_events",
"type": "User",
"site_admin": false
},
"private": false,
"html_url": "https://github.com/mietzmithut/Test",
"description": "",
"fork": false,
"url": "https://api.github.com/repos/mietzmithut/Test",
"forks_url": "https://api.github.com/repos/mietzmithut/Test/forks",
"keys_url": "https://api.github.com/repos/mietzmithut/Test/keys{/key_id}",
"collaborators_url": "https://api.github.com/repos/mietzmithut/Test/collaborators{/collaborator}",
"teams_url": "https://api.github.com/repos/mietzmithut/Test/teams",
"hooks_url": "https://api.github.com/repos/mietzmithut/Test/hooks",
"issue_events_url": "https://api.github.com/repos/mietzmithut/Test/issues/events{/number}",
"events_url": "https://api.github.com/repos/mietzmithut/Test/events",
"assignees_url": "https://api.github.com/repos/mietzmithut/Test/assignees{/user}",
"branches_url": "https://api.github.com/repos/mietzmithut/Test/branches{/branch}",
"tags_url": "https://api.github.com/repos/mietzmithut/Test/tags",
"blobs_url": "https://api.github.com/repos/mietzmithut/Test/git/blobs{/sha}",
"git_tags_url": "https://api.github.com/repos/mietzmithut/Test/git/tags{/sha}",
"git_refs_url": "https://api.github.com/repos/mietzmithut/Test/git/refs{/sha}",
"trees_url": "https://api.github.com/repos/mietzmithut/Test/git/trees{/sha}",
"statuses_url": "https://api.github.com/repos/mietzmithut/Test/statuses/{sha}",
"languages_url": "https://api.github.com/repos/mietzmithut/Test/languages",
"stargazers_url": "https://api.github.com/repos/mietzmithut/Test/stargazers",
"contributors_url": "https://api.github.com/repos/mietzmithut/Test/contributors",
"subscribers_url": "https://api.github.com/repos/mietzmithut/Test/subscribers",
"subscription_url": "https://api.github.com/repos/mietzmithut/Test/subscription",
"commits_url": "https://api.github.com/repos/mietzmithut/Test/commits{/sha}",
"git_commits_url": "https://api.github.com/repos/mietzmithut/Test/git/commits{/sha}",
"comments_url": "https://api.github.com/repos/mietzmithut/Test/comments{/number}",
"issue_comment_url": "https://api.github.com/repos/mietzmithut/Test/issues/comments/{number}",
"contents_url": "https://api.github.com/repos/mietzmithut/Test/contents/{+path}",
"compare_url": "https://api.github.com/repos/mietzmithut/Test/compare/{base}...{head}",
"merges_url": "https://api.github.com/repos/mietzmithut/Test/merges",
"archive_url": "https://api.github.com/repos/mietzmithut/Test/{archive_format}{/ref}",
"downloads_url": "https://api.github.com/repos/mietzmithut/Test/downloads",
"issues_url": "https://api.github.com/repos/mietzmithut/Test/issues{/number}",
"pulls_url": "https://api.github.com/repos/mietzmithut/Test/pulls{/number}",
"milestones_url": "https://api.github.com/repos/mietzmithut/Test/milestones{/number}",
"notifications_url": "https://api.github.com/repos/mietzmithut/Test/notifications{?since,all,participating}",
"labels_url": "https://api.github.com/repos/mietzmithut/Test/labels{/name}",
"releases_url": "https://api.github.com/repos/mietzmithut/Test/releases{/id}",
"created_at": "2013-06-20T17:05:03Z",
"updated_at": "2014-06-13T21:10:35Z",
"pushed_at": "2013-06-20T20:04:46Z",
"git_url": "git://github.com/mietzmithut/Test.git",
"ssh_url": "[email protected]:mietzmithut/Test.git",
"clone_url": "https://github.com/mietzmithut/Test.git",
"svn_url": "https://github.com/mietzmithut/Test",
"homepage": null,
"size": 132,
"stargazers_count": 0,
"watchers_count": 0,
"language": "Ruby",
"has_issues": true,
"has_downloads": true,
"has_wiki": true,
"has_pages": false,
"forks_count": 0,
"mirror_url": null,
"open_issues_count": 0,
"forks": 0,
"open_issues": 0,
"watchers": 0,
"default_branch": "master",
"network_count": 0,
"subscribers_count": 2
}
43 changes: 43 additions & 0 deletions GithubPilotTests/FakeData/user_me.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,43 @@
{
"login": "pietbrauer",
"id": 759730,
"avatar_url": "https://avatars.githubusercontent.com/u/759730?v=3",
"gravatar_id": "",
"url": "https://api.github.com/users/pietbrauer",
"html_url": "https://github.com/pietbrauer",
"followers_url": "https://api.github.com/users/pietbrauer/followers",
"following_url": "https://api.github.com/users/pietbrauer/following{/other_user}",
"gists_url": "https://api.github.com/users/pietbrauer/gists{/gist_id}",
"starred_url": "https://api.github.com/users/pietbrauer/starred{/owner}{/repo}",
"subscriptions_url": "https://api.github.com/users/pietbrauer/subscriptions",
"organizations_url": "https://api.github.com/users/pietbrauer/orgs",
"repos_url": "https://api.github.com/users/pietbrauer/repos",
"events_url": "https://api.github.com/users/pietbrauer/events{/privacy}",
"received_events_url": "https://api.github.com/users/pietbrauer/received_events",
"type": "User",
"site_admin": false,
"name": "Piet Brauer",
"company": "XING AG",
"blog": "xing.to/PietBrauer",
"location": "Hamburg",
"email": null,
"hireable": true,
"bio": null,
"public_repos": 6,
"public_gists": 10,
"followers": 41,
"following": 19,
"created_at": "2011-04-29T20:58:36Z",
"updated_at": "2015-01-12T19:42:23Z",
"private_gists": 7,
"total_private_repos": 4,
"owned_private_repos": 4,
"disk_usage": 49064,
"collaborators": 2,
"plan": {
"name": "micro",
"space": 614400,
"collaborators": 0,
"private_repos": 5
}
}
32 changes: 32 additions & 0 deletions GithubPilotTests/FakeData/user_mietzmithut.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@
{
"login": "mietzmithut",
"id": 4672699,
"avatar_url": "https://avatars.githubusercontent.com/u/4672699?v=3",
"gravatar_id": "",
"url": "https://api.github.com/users/mietzmithut",
"html_url": "https://github.com/mietzmithut",
"followers_url": "https://api.github.com/users/mietzmithut/followers",
"following_url": "https://api.github.com/users/mietzmithut/following{/other_user}",
"gists_url": "https://api.github.com/users/mietzmithut/gists{/gist_id}",
"starred_url": "https://api.github.com/users/mietzmithut/starred{/owner}{/repo}",
"subscriptions_url": "https://api.github.com/users/mietzmithut/subscriptions",
"organizations_url": "https://api.github.com/users/mietzmithut/orgs",
"repos_url": "https://api.github.com/users/mietzmithut/repos",
"events_url": "https://api.github.com/users/mietzmithut/events{/privacy}",
"received_events_url": "https://api.github.com/users/mietzmithut/received_events",
"type": "User",
"site_admin": false,
"name": "Julia Kallenberg",
"company": "",
"blog": "",
"location": "Hamburg",
"email": "",
"hireable": false,
"bio": null,
"public_repos": 7,
"public_gists": 0,
"followers": 7,
"following": 8,
"created_at": "2013-06-11T18:02:51Z",
"updated_at": "2014-12-22T18:53:41Z"
}
94 changes: 94 additions & 0 deletions GithubPilotTests/FakeData/user_repos.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,94 @@
[
{
"id": 10824973,
"name": "Test",
"full_name": "mietzmithut/Test",
"owner": {
"login": "mietzmithut",
"id": 4672699,
"avatar_url": "https://avatars.githubusercontent.com/u/4672699?v=3",
"gravatar_id": "",
"url": "https://api.github.com/users/mietzmithut",
"html_url": "https://github.com/mietzmithut",
"followers_url": "https://api.github.com/users/mietzmithut/followers",
"following_url": "https://api.github.com/users/mietzmithut/following{/other_user}",
"gists_url": "https://api.github.com/users/mietzmithut/gists{/gist_id}",
"starred_url": "https://api.github.com/users/mietzmithut/starred{/owner}{/repo}",
"subscriptions_url": "https://api.github.com/users/mietzmithut/subscriptions",
"organizations_url": "https://api.github.com/users/mietzmithut/orgs",
"repos_url": "https://api.github.com/users/mietzmithut/repos",
"events_url": "https://api.github.com/users/mietzmithut/events{/privacy}",
"received_events_url": "https://api.github.com/users/mietzmithut/received_events",
"type": "User",
"site_admin": false
},
"private": false,
"html_url": "https://github.com/mietzmithut/Test",
"description": "",
"fork": false,
"url": "https://api.github.com/repos/mietzmithut/Test",
"forks_url": "https://api.github.com/repos/mietzmithut/Test/forks",
"keys_url": "https://api.github.com/repos/mietzmithut/Test/keys{/key_id}",
"collaborators_url": "https://api.github.com/repos/mietzmithut/Test/collaborators{/collaborator}",
"teams_url": "https://api.github.com/repos/mietzmithut/Test/teams",
"hooks_url": "https://api.github.com/repos/mietzmithut/Test/hooks",
"issue_events_url": "https://api.github.com/repos/mietzmithut/Test/issues/events{/number}",
"events_url": "https://api.github.com/repos/mietzmithut/Test/events",
"assignees_url": "https://api.github.com/repos/mietzmithut/Test/assignees{/user}",
"branches_url": "https://api.github.com/repos/mietzmithut/Test/branches{/branch}",
"tags_url": "https://api.github.com/repos/mietzmithut/Test/tags",
"blobs_url": "https://api.github.com/repos/mietzmithut/Test/git/blobs{/sha}",
"git_tags_url": "https://api.github.com/repos/mietzmithut/Test/git/tags{/sha}",
"git_refs_url": "https://api.github.com/repos/mietzmithut/Test/git/refs{/sha}",
"trees_url": "https://api.github.com/repos/mietzmithut/Test/git/trees{/sha}",
"statuses_url": "https://api.github.com/repos/mietzmithut/Test/statuses/{sha}",
"languages_url": "https://api.github.com/repos/mietzmithut/Test/languages",
"stargazers_url": "https://api.github.com/repos/mietzmithut/Test/stargazers",
"contributors_url": "https://api.github.com/repos/mietzmithut/Test/contributors",
"subscribers_url": "https://api.github.com/repos/mietzmithut/Test/subscribers",
"subscription_url": "https://api.github.com/repos/mietzmithut/Test/subscription",
"commits_url": "https://api.github.com/repos/mietzmithut/Test/commits{/sha}",
"git_commits_url": "https://api.github.com/repos/mietzmithut/Test/git/commits{/sha}",
"comments_url": "https://api.github.com/repos/mietzmithut/Test/comments{/number}",
"issue_comment_url": "https://api.github.com/repos/mietzmithut/Test/issues/comments/{number}",
"contents_url": "https://api.github.com/repos/mietzmithut/Test/contents/{+path}",
"compare_url": "https://api.github.com/repos/mietzmithut/Test/compare/{base}...{head}",
"merges_url": "https://api.github.com/repos/mietzmithut/Test/merges",
"archive_url": "https://api.github.com/repos/mietzmithut/Test/{archive_format}{/ref}",
"downloads_url": "https://api.github.com/repos/mietzmithut/Test/downloads",
"issues_url": "https://api.github.com/repos/mietzmithut/Test/issues{/number}",
"pulls_url": "https://api.github.com/repos/mietzmithut/Test/pulls{/number}",
"milestones_url": "https://api.github.com/repos/mietzmithut/Test/milestones{/number}",
"notifications_url": "https://api.github.com/repos/mietzmithut/Test/notifications{?since,all,participating}",
"labels_url": "https://api.github.com/repos/mietzmithut/Test/labels{/name}",
"releases_url": "https://api.github.com/repos/mietzmithut/Test/releases{/id}",
"created_at": "2013-06-20T17:05:03Z",
"updated_at": "2014-06-13T21:10:35Z",
"pushed_at": "2013-06-20T20:04:46Z",
"git_url": "git://github.com/mietzmithut/Test.git",
"ssh_url": "[email protected]:mietzmithut/Test.git",
"clone_url": "https://github.com/mietzmithut/Test.git",
"svn_url": "https://github.com/mietzmithut/Test",
"homepage": null,
"size": 132,
"stargazers_count": 0,
"watchers_count": 0,
"language": "Ruby",
"has_issues": true,
"has_downloads": true,
"has_wiki": true,
"has_pages": false,
"forks_count": 0,
"mirror_url": null,
"open_issues_count": 0,
"forks": 0,
"open_issues": 0,
"watchers": 0,
"default_branch": "master",
"permissions": {
"admin": false,
"push": true,
"pull": true
}
}
]
45 changes: 45 additions & 0 deletions GithubPilotTests/FakeData/users.json
Original file line number Diff line number Diff line change
@@ -0,0 +1,45 @@
[
{
"login": "pietbrauer",
"id": 759730,
"avatar_url": "https://avatars.githubusercontent.com/u/759730?v=3",
"gravatar_id": "",
"url": "https://api.github.com/users/pietbrauer",
"html_url": "https://github.com/pietbrauer",
"followers_url": "https://api.github.com/users/pietbrauer/followers",
"following_url": "https://api.github.com/users/pietbrauer/following{/other_user}",
"gists_url": "https://api.github.com/users/pietbrauer/gists{/gist_id}",
"starred_url": "https://api.github.com/users/pietbrauer/starred{/owner}{/repo}",
"subscriptions_url": "https://api.github.com/users/pietbrauer/subscriptions",
"organizations_url": "https://api.github.com/users/pietbrauer/orgs",
"repos_url": "https://api.github.com/users/pietbrauer/repos",
"events_url": "https://api.github.com/users/pietbrauer/events{/privacy}",
"received_events_url": "https://api.github.com/users/pietbrauer/received_events",
"type": "User",
"site_admin": false,
"name": "Piet Brauer",
"company": "XING AG",
"blog": "xing.to/PietBrauer",
"location": "Hamburg",
"email": null,
"hireable": true,
"bio": null,
"public_repos": 6,
"public_gists": 10,
"followers": 41,
"following": 19,
"created_at": "2011-04-29T20:58:36Z",
"updated_at": "2015-01-12T19:42:23Z",
"private_gists": 7,
"total_private_repos": 4,
"owned_private_repos": 4,
"disk_usage": 49064,
"collaborators": 2,
"plan": {
"name": "micro",
"space": 614400,
"collaborators": 0,
"private_repos": 5
}
}
]
32 changes: 32 additions & 0 deletions GithubPilotTests/TestHelper.swift
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@
//
// TestHelper.swift
// GithubPilot
//
// Created by yansong li on 2016-02-20.
// Copyright © 2016 yansong li. All rights reserved.
//


// Get From: https://github.com/nerdishbynature/octokit.swift
import Foundation

internal class Helper {
internal class func stringFromFile(name: String) -> String? {
let bundle = NSBundle(forClass: self)
let path = bundle.pathForResource(name, ofType: "json")
if let path = path {
let string = try? String(contentsOfFile: path, encoding: NSUTF8StringEncoding)
return string
}
return nil
}

internal class func JSONFromFile(name: String) -> AnyObject {
let bundle = NSBundle(forClass: self)
let path = bundle.pathForResource(name, ofType: "json")!
let data = NSData(contentsOfFile: path)!
let dict: AnyObject? = try? NSJSONSerialization.JSONObjectWithData(data,
options: NSJSONReadingOptions.MutableContainers)
return dict!
}
}
14 changes: 14 additions & 0 deletions Podfile
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
# Uncomment this line to define a global platform for your project
# platform :ios, '8.0'
# Uncomment this line if you're using Swift
use_frameworks!

target 'GithubPilot' do
pod 'Alamofire'
end

target 'GithubPilotTests' do
pod 'Nocilla'
pod 'GithubPilot', '~>0.1.1'
end

17 changes: 17 additions & 0 deletions Podfile.lock
Original file line number Diff line number Diff line change
@@ -0,0 +1,17 @@
PODS:
- Alamofire (3.2.0)
- GithubPilot (0.1.1):
- Alamofire (~> 3.0)
- Nocilla (0.10.0)

DEPENDENCIES:
- Alamofire
- GithubPilot (~> 0.1.1)
- Nocilla

SPEC CHECKSUMS:
Alamofire: 4da478599fccddff361205c8929333d7fe18dceb
GithubPilot: 03674649f3df996c717cfc24c7804bffb033620a
Nocilla: ae0a2b05f3087b473624ac2b25903695df51246a

COCOAPODS: 0.39.0
Loading

0 comments on commit 90b054c

Please sign in to comment.